MTN Rwanda launches Callertunez Awards 2026 to celebrate creative spirit

Building on this growing culture of digital self-expression, MTN Rwanda has launched the Callertunez Awards 2026, a platform designed to celebrate Rwanda’s creative industry while empowering local artists through MTN Caller Tunes services.

This initiative reflects MTN Rwanda’s commitment to creating opportunities for young creatives, artists, storytellers and entertainers to grow their audiences, increase their visibility and earn through digital platforms.

The awards recognize the creators behind the sounds and messages that millions of Rwandans engage with daily through Caller Tunes, transforming ordinary calls into personalized experiences filled with music, inspiration, humor and culture.

The competition will bring together artists on the MTN Caller Tune platform, who will compete across three categories: music, comedy, and praise & poetry. Winners will be selected based on a combination of public voting and subscription performance.

In the music category, the winner will receive 12,000,000 RWF, the first runner-up 5,000,000 RWF, and the second runner-up 3,000,000 RWF. In the comedy category, the winner will take home 2,000,000 RWF, while the praise & poetry category winner will also receive 2,000,000 RWF.

Customers can support their favorite artists by voting through *193 *2026*ArtistCode# and subscribing through *193#.

Fans can also follow the live leaderboard and access artist codes through Callertunez Awards Platform or by dialing *193# and selecting the CRBT Awards menu.

The campaign will run alongside the 2026 MTN Iwacu Muzika Festival, culminating in a grand finale during the festival’s final show in Rubavu on 1 August 2026.
